dc.abstract.enTell el-Farkha is a site in the eastern Nile Delta, which documents a span of more than 1000 years (c. 3700 – 2600 BC). From the beginning of its settlement, trade was the most important area of the economy for the inhabitants of the Tell el-Farkha. They established very intensive and highly developed trade relations with the Near East from one side and Upper Egypt from another. During the last three centuries of the 4th millennium BC Tell el-Farkha was probably the most important economic and political centre in the eastern Nile Delta.pl
